Conexus Welcomes Newest Board Members from Essilor Vision Foundation and VSP

6/28/2016

0 Comments

 
​On June 6th, Conexus’ newest board members, Dennis Mayo, Director of Programs and Operations, Essilor Vision Foundation, and Danny Singer, VP Eastern Region Lab Operations, VSP made their first trip to the Conexus headquarters in Richmond, VA. 

Mayo and Singer flew in to participate in their first board meeting and the 25th Annual Conexus Golf Classic, which netted more than $105,000 in support of Conexus’ comprehensive children’s vision programs. The two spent the following day touring the recently renovated Conexus headquarters and spending time with Conexus senior staff to learn more about the organization and how their new roles on the Board can help to expand the reach of Conexus, both in geographic service to children and within the vision industry.

“Bringing representation of two industry giants to the Conexus Board is an important growth initiative of the organization,” says Tim Gresham, Conexus President and CEO.  “Inviting Dennis and Danny to the Board seemed like a natural fit.  VSP has long supported the work of Conexus through their Sight for Students voucher program, and recently Conexus has had the privilege of partnering with Essilor Vision Foundation on two significant children’s vision initiatives in Virginia.” 

​“Danny and Dennis bring insight that can broaden our perspective and our reach, and they each represent unique qualities as individuals and professionals that will continue to strengthen and diversify our board,” says Ed Greene, Conexus Board member and former President of The Vision Council.  Greene, who uses his expertise to guide the strategic planning process of the organization, views Mayo and Singer as “real assets to the organization as we move forward to expand our mission.”

Conexus works to help every child reach their fullest potential by eliminating undetected and untreated vision problems as barriers to success in school and life.  The signature program, VisioCheck, is a technology based comprehensive children’s vision program that is primarily used in school-based settings to support school health.  “VisioCheck is gaining in recognition as well as reputation, and is one of the most advanced children’s vision programs in the nation,” remarks Dr. Charles Pegram, Conexus Board Chair.  “What’s really setting our organization and our programs apart is the extensive amount of hard data.  It’s undeniably demonstrating a real need for improved programs for children’s vision and setting some pretty impressive standards.  We’re excited about the direction our programs are taking and we look forward to bringing Dennis and Danny into the leadership of our organization!”

A Tradition of Saving Sight
Conexus, formerly known as Prevent Blindness Mid-Atlantic, was established in 1957 as the National Society to Prevent Blindness - Virginia Affiliate. Throughout our history, our name has changed to reflect our vision and reach, but our mission is clear: eliminating undetected and untreated vision problems as barriers to success, enabling all children to reach their fullest potential.
